I started my dreads and "maintained" them via the crochet method. I stopped crocheting them about 3 months ago. They are getting softer, albeit slowly...

However, now I have tons of stray hairs that stick out everywhere!! Please tell me they will start to dread on their own someday??

Anything to do with the tips?


Dread Maintenance

I think curly little ends are awesome- I have a few myself. If your ends dont dread up on their own they will eventually break off and your ends will become rounder in time. My friends dreads did exactly that. She had long wispy ends and now they are very round.

As SE said, leave them alone ;)
